1. Visual Inspection
Color Consistency
Authentic Black EVA Fabrics have a uniform black color. The hue should be consistent across the entire surface of the fabric without any visible patches of faded color or unevenness. In counterfeit products, you may notice that the black color appears blotchy or has a grayish undertone in some areas. This is often due to the use of inferior or improper dyes during the manufacturing process.
Surface Texture
Run your hand over the fabric. Genuine Black EVA Fabrics will have a smooth yet slightly textured surface. This texture is a result of the manufacturing process that gives the fabric its unique feel. Counterfeit fabrics may feel overly smooth, almost slippery, or too rough, as if the wrong additives or processing techniques were used.


Gloss and Finish
Authentic EVA fabrics usually have a subtle, even gloss. The finish should not be overly shiny, which can indicate the use of low - quality additives in imitations. A high - quality Black EVA Fabric will have a satin - like finish that gives it a professional and durable appearance.
2. Physical Properties Testing
Tensile Strength
Take a small sample of the fabric and gently tug on it. Bonafide Black EVA Fabrics have good tensile strength. They can withstand a certain amount of pulling force without tearing easily. Counterfeit fabrics may rip or stretch excessively under relatively low stress. This is because they are often made from substandard polymers or have an improper cross - linking structure.
Flexibility
Bend the fabric. Authentic EVA fabrics are flexible and can be bent multiple times without cracking or showing signs of brittleness. If the fabric cracks or breaks when bent slightly, it is likely a fake. The flexibility of genuine Black EVA Fabrics comes from the proper formulation of ethylene - vinyl acetate (EVA) copolymers and the addition of appropriate plasticizers.
3. Chemical Analysis
Solubility Test
Although this test should be carried out with caution, a simple solubility test can provide some clues. Authentic EVA fabrics are insoluble in water but may dissolve or swell slightly in certain organic solvents such as toluene or acetone. However, counterfeit fabrics may have different solubility characteristics due to the use of other polymers or additives. It is important to note that this test should only be done on small, inconspicuous samples and in a well - ventilated area.
Fourier - Transform Infrared Spectroscopy (FTIR)
FTIR is a more advanced method. It analyzes the chemical bonds in the fabric. Authentic Black EVA Fabrics will show characteristic peaks in the FTIR spectrum corresponding to the EVA polymer. Counterfeit products may have additional or missing peaks, indicating the presence of other substances or a different polymer composition. This method requires specialized equipment and trained personnel.
4. Manufacturer and Supplier Verification
Reputation
Research the manufacturer and supplier of the Black EVA Fabrics. A reputable supplier will have a long - standing presence in the market, positive customer reviews, and a history of providing high - quality products. Check industry forums, trade associations, and online business directories for information about the supplier's reputation.
Certifications
Genuine Black EVA Fabrics are often accompanied by relevant certifications. These can include quality management certifications such as ISO 9001, environmental certifications, or product - specific certifications. Ask the supplier for copies of these certifications and verify their authenticity with the issuing organizations.
5. Comparison with Known Samples
If you have access to a sample of authentic Black EVA Fabrics, compare it directly with the fabric in question. Look for differences in color, texture, physical properties, and any other observable characteristics. This side - by - side comparison can be a quick and effective way to detect potential counterfeits.
